    This is the kind of bar you would go to just to chill, chat or have some pre-party drinks..No…read moreworries, its a good decision! The laidback athmosphere attracts all kinds of people, which creates the perfect opportunity to get to meet new, crazy (drunk?) people to have a fun night with. The way my Dutch friends described this place is the exact way how to put it : Something like a club sports house or squad. I love the retro/trashy decoration, especially the Kitty cat motive on the wall, in the hall that leads to the other (dance) room; crazy but fun. Prices are reasonable and the bartenders are just as easy going as the crowd. Downstairs, next to the toilets, theres another dancefloor which is only opened on special and/or crowded nights. Music is great; on fridays kind of hiphop/rnb/reggae, on saturdays more electronic sounds and on sundays jazz/lounge. During the week its not too crowded, so you can chill on the sofas, play some table football, have profound conversations or find yourself doing intellectual stuff on your laptop. You can even buy candy if you get hungry, at the bar just next to the entrance! Awesome!

    I saw a post-hardcore band here and while I enjoyed the show, I found Docks had some very strange…read moreand frustrating organisation and design issues which haven't left me with a great impression. My main complaint is the cloakroom/coat check, which was an absolute nightmare and definitely the worst I've ever encountered. As soon as I had my ticket checked and went through the main door, bang, I was already in the cloakroom queue. And not only was this queue soul-destroyingly slow, it snaked around the whole venue, and that's not an exaggeration. It turned left past the bar, the merch table, another bar, the toilets, then it turned right up the stairs, went across the entire upper tier (going past another bar, naturally) and finally turned right down half a flight of stairs. When I got there, it was two guys in a 1 metre squared hole in the wall. For a 1,000+ capacity venue, that's absolutely ludicrous. By this time, I'd been queuing for half an hour and had missed the entire support slot, even though I was in the queue when doors opened. Another peculiarity was the standing area. Naturally it was riddled with mosh pits, which was fine for the most part. However, there's some funny tiered standing areas at the sides which are incredibly hard to see in the dark, resulting in a fair amount of tripping as the crowd churned. Luckily, everyone was quick to help each other up, so it wasn't a massive issue. Just something to watch out for. I'm not sure I'd come back here unless I was really keen on the band. And if I did, I definitely wouldn't bring a coat.
